Ozigbo Falls Short as Ukachukwu Clinches APC Governorship Ticket in Anambra

 

Nicholas Ukachukwu has emerged as the All Progressives Congress (APC) flag bearer for the upcoming Anambra governorship election scheduled for November 2025. Ukachukwu secured the ticket after a landslide victory in the party’s primary held on Saturday, where he polled 1,455 votes to defeat his closest rival, Valentine Ozigbo, who managed just 67 votes.

 

The election is expected to be one of Nigeria’s major off-cycle polls, with incumbent Governor Chukwuma Soludo already clinching the ticket of the All Progressives Grand Alliance (APGA), the ruling party in the state.

 

Following his victory, Ukachukwu expressed confidence in his ability to lead the APC to success in Anambra. “We shall deliver Anambra to the APC. One thing I want to say here, nobody has won the governorship of Anambra without my support; it has never happened before,” he said. “I have been playing godfatherism, but now I want to be the father of the father, no more godfather.”
